Transaction f399e14987dc6166b804d140e691545cc1ff28bb3d4a79e5cb5ab9ff27f550ad
3 Input
2 Outputs
- f399e14987dc6166b804d140e691545cc1ff28bb3d4a79e5cb5ab9ff27f550ad:0
- f399e14987dc6166b804d140e691545cc1ff28bb3d4a79e5cb5ab9ff27f550ad:1
value 822059
address 31uWWFtQ2hBhqbsjWaA5aAr6BewoYJfNUy
value 107981
address 13VoC4uQPQWBu2arA1NTEsg9zz8CTqLoKK